A late post I know on this thread, but I couldn't of posted last night with a clear mind. We've played Wigan before and struggled with their formation when they play 3 at the back. So massive credit last night for Pulis for matching them up in that respect and I thought for the first 50 minutes we were cruising, 2-0 up and I thought we looked comfortable. I think after they scored we looked like a team who were low on confidence then. But what sealed it were the subs. I thought Adam was having a decent game, he was allowed more of a free role and some things didn't come off that he tried, but it was good to see him having the confidence back again. Once he went off then we lost that extra body in midfield with a bit more guile. I have no idea what TP was thinking to drop SJW back in to centre midfield though. Once Wilko came on I fully expected us to go 4-4-2 with walters/whitehead/whelan/ethers making up the midfield 4. Frankly the formation that worked so well for 50 minutes turned into a mess in the second half. Once TP made the changes, he brought on players that couldn't fit into that formation. Wilko to right wing back? SJW in to centre mid? We should have gone back to basics when it was clear at 2-2 that we were struggling. You could visibly see players looking over to the manager to understand what they were supposed to be doing. But I will say it worked well first half and the mistake TP made was keeping that system for the second half when he started to change players and clearly some of them seemed clueless what to do. Worst of it though was seeing the players visibly losing their fight and not pressing the ball.
